Frequently Asked Questions
What is the CareGrader rating for D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ER?
D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ER in SALEM, Illinois has a CareGrader grade of D (Below Average), with a composite score of 63.5 out of 100. This grade is based on health inspections, staffing levels, quality measures, and penalty history from official CMS government data.
What is the CMS star rating for D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ER?
D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ER has an overall CMS star rating of 1 out of 5, a health inspection rating of 3/5, and a staffing rating of 1/5. CareGrader combines this with additional data to calculate an A-F grade.
How many health deficiencies does D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ER have?
D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ER has 21 health deficiencies on record from CMS health inspection surveys. Deficiencies are rated from A (minimal harm potential) to L (immediate jeopardy, widespread). View the full inspection timeline above for details on each deficiency.
Has D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ER been fined?
Yes. D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ER has $67,088 in total fines from CMS enforcement actions across 2 penalties.
How many beds does D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ER have?
DOCTORS NURSING & REHAB CENTER has 120 certified beds with approximately 59 current residents (49% occupancy). The facility is located at 1201 HAWTHORN ROAD, SALEM, Illinois 62881. It is a for profit - limited liability company facility.
